> The following recipe might help:
>
> ---
> mkdir kdb-parisc
> cd kdb-parisc
> export CVSROOT=:pserver:anonymous@cvs.parisc-linux.org:/var/cvs
> cvs login
> cvs co linux
> cvs co palo
> mkdir kdb
> cd kdb
> wget
> ftp://oss.sgi.com/projects/kdb/download/v2.1/kdb-v2.1-2.4.18-common-3.bz2
> bunzip2 kdb-v2.1-2.4.18-common-3.bz2
> wget
> http://www.baldric.uwo.ca/~carlos/kdb-parisc/kdb-v2.1-2.4.18-pa23-parisc.bz2
> bunzip2 kdb-v2.1-2.4.18-pa23-parisc.bz2
> cd ../linux
> patch -p1 < ../kdb/kdb-v2.1-2.4.18-common-3
> patch -p1 < ../kdb/kdb-v2.1-2.4.18-pa23-parisc
> make oldconfig (Answer CPU and KDB questions)
> (You can alternatively configure other things)
> make dep
> make palo
> ---
>
> I won't be maintaining kdb patches outside the CVS try anymore,
> so the second wget will soon become a cvs checkout.

Many thanks for explanation.
Right now, I just update the kdb21 branch that Paul update for -pa24 stuff.
Unfortunately I do not reach to boot it (test it with gcc-3.0.4 and gcc-3.1 co
two days ago). It seems to hang just after the message:
"...
a common symtom -- search the FAQ ..."
I also check that I can boot 2.4.18-pa24:
gcc 3.0.4 ok
gcc 3.1 hang just after Freeing Init mem (364k)
Well I let you work and I will update kdb branch latter and try again.
